well i figured i would block the tire unstead of doin a emergency brake burny because im pretty sure its not to good on the brake lol but can i?

gouldie 03-02-2007 04:58 PM

Re: Burn out pics?
 
you cant do an emergency brake stand because the emergency brake will stop the rear tires. when i usually do them i play with the regular brake a little because the front tires will get most of the braking force.

if it's an auto then it'll be easy, if not it will take a little practice to work the clutch, brake and gas at the same time
